Okay, so the game is a month old. I was slow to pick it up, because I thought I was done with FPS games. My video card is mediocre, I've experienced DOOM-sickness in first-person games since my mid-20's, and I'm really tired of drab brown environments and military themes.

Then, last night I got bored. I've been reading through a lot of Shadowrun material and I was in the mood for a cyberpunk-themed game. I downloaded the Hard Reset demo and...wow. The cut scenes aren't that great, but the atmosphere in-game is awesome, and I can see a lot of potential in the weapon upgrade system. Has anyone else played this? I'm kind of surprised that there isn't already a topic for the game.

There's a demo on Steam (that's where I got it from) and more general info on their site. I haven't bought the full version yet, as I've heard that the game is kind of short and I'm thinking about waiting for a Steam sale, but I highly recommend the demo.
